Carsten Klein wrote on 18.05.2010 23:35: > actually, your application server is not using the system's default > timezone, see the configuration of your server. The timezone is correct. The DST information seems to be "broken". Besides: I'm not using an application server. It's a Swing application that retrieves the data via JDBC The output from my initial post was from a very simply main() class, only runs that single statement I posted in my initialpost. Even then it only works when I manually set user.timezone=GMT+2 And for the test case the client application _and_ Postgres were running on the same physical machine. So the JVM (and thusthe JDBC driver) and Postgres should use the same timezone information from my Windows. When I output the value of user.timezone (when not setting it manually) it does report the correct one: Europe/Berlin, butfor some reason it does not apply the DST settings correctly. > In order to overcome this problem, I have adjusted a db layer that we are > using in the OSS VerA.Web project so that it will use proxies for the most > relevant objects (resultset and so on) that then will just drop the > timezone information in the data received from the database, so that when > instantiating the datetime object in the application server, it will > automatically take over the configured timezone.
